All rights reserved.Using Your Remote Control  Remote Starting Your VehicleThe system WILL NOT start the vehicle if any one of the followingsituations exist:1. The vehicle's hood is opened.2. The gear shift selector is not in Park.3. The brake pedal is depressed.1. To start the vehicle, press and release the   button 2 times within 2seconds.  The vehicle will start and remain running for the pre-programmed 5, 10, 15, 20 minute run cycle.  As a visual indication, theparking lights will flash or remain on depending on the setting by yourinstallation center.2.  When you arrive at the vehicle, turn the ignition key to the ON position (Donot try to restart the vehicle), then step on the brake pedal to disengagethe remote start.  The vehicle will continue to run, but now on it's ownpower. Shutting Down the Remote StartTo shut down the remote start feature from the transmitter press andrelease the   button 2 times within 2 seconds.  Unlocking the Vehicle (optional)To unlock the vehicle's doors press and hold the   button for 3 secondsanytime the vehicle is remote started.Note: Additional parts and/or labor may be necessary, see your installingdealer for details.

Operating the 2 / 3 Hour Start Up Timer ModeThe system has the ability to start the vehicle every 2 or 3 hours with aMAXIMUM of 6 start cycles. This feature is especially useful in coldclimates where the only means to keep the engine and engine fluidswarm is to periodically start the engine. The default setting is 3 hour,Selection between  2 or 3 hour is made in option programming.WARNING!Be certain that the vehicle is outdoors before using this or any remotestarting device.  A running engine produces dangerous carbon monoxidefumes which can be harmful or fatal if prolonged exposure occurs.  DONOT remote start the vehicle if it is garaged.To begin the 2 / 3 hour start up timer mode:1. Turn the vehicle’s ignition ON then OFF.2. Press and hold the valet button.3. Press the   button 4 times, the system will chirp 2 times.4. Release the valet button.To exit the 2 / 3 hour start up timer mode:1. Turn the vehicle’s Ignition ON.OR1. Activate the remote vehicle start feature using the remote                  control.

All rights reserved.Transmitter Button Functions1 Button Transmitter Start / Aux Operation MethodUnlock XPress and Hold - During remote start onlyRemote Start XPress and Release (1 or 2 times depending on selectable option) Remote Start Shut Down XPress and Release (1 or 2 times depending on selectable option)  Valet ModeValet Mode is used to disable the system from remote starting. Toenter or exit valet mode simply follow the 4 steps outlined below:1. Turn the vehicle’s ignition ON.2. Push and hold the programming/valet button.3. The LED will turn on solid when valet mode is active4. Release the programming/valet button.
